Volleyball owns Sixth Street with straight set win

CLAREMONT, Calif. – In their first meeting in the 2016 season, Claremont-Mudd-Scripps made quick work of the Pomona-Pitzer volleyball team, winning 3-0 (25-12, 25-13, 25-14). In the match, juniors Shelbi Stein (CMC) and Crystal Anderson (CMC) each hit over .420 with 17 kills combined.

The Athenas controlled the game from the very beginning. Junior setter Clara Madsen (CMC) served for six points in a row including an ace for the 7-0 lead. The Sagehens hurt their chances initially with 10 errors in the first set, ultimately hitting -.065.

CMS was almost able to keep its errors for the match in single digits with just 12 on the afternoon.

The No. 2 ranked Athenas demonstrated their dominance with a team hitting percentage of .267 and nine aces in the match. There were neither reception errors nor service errors for CMS in all three sets.

Defensively, junior libero Mikena Werner (SC) made 12 digs of the team's 30 while senior Nicole Kerkhof (CMC) contributed eight.

Anderson and Stein found success in each of the sets as Madsen executed her set placements with precision.

CMS remains undefeated in the 2016 campaign at 16-0, and at the top of the conference at 8-0 in SCIAC. The Athenas host Chapman (9-9, 4-5 SCIAC) on Tuesday, Oct. 11 in Roberts Pavilion.
